96.69 percent of the population in 32442 drive to work alone. 0.00 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 49.61 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 9.29 percent of the residents in 32442 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.11 members with about 2.16 cars available per household.
An estimate of 94.76 percent of the residents in 32442 has some form of health insurance. 58.21 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 48.79 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 32442 would have to travel an average of 15.08 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Jackson Hospital .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 32442, Grand Ridge, Florida.

As of , an estimate of 3,568 residents live in 32442 with a median age of 40.1 years. 26.23 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 19.03 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 42.57 percent of the residents in 32442 is currently married, and 13.70 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 32442 is $4,166.67.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 32442 is approximately $618. The median household spends about 14.83 percent of their income on housing.
